Largest Available Lynnville and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Lynnville, KY is found at The W on Broadway and is 1,220 square feet priced from $2,600. Riverstone Apartments has the second largest 1 Bedroom, which is sized at 701 square feet and currently listed start at $950. Cheapest Available Lynnville and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of May 10,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Lynnville, KY is the 1 Bedroom - Jackson House Model starting from $781 at Jackson House . The second most affordable Lynnville 1 Bedroom is the One Bedroom Model at South Towne Commons - NOW PRELEASING starting at $875 . The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Lynnville is currently $1,447.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Lynnville:
